Overview
KEMETs Radial Solid Polymer Aluminum Capacitors offer longer life and greater stability across a wide range of temperatures. This highly conductive solid polymer electrolyte eliminates the risk of drying out and, due to its low ESR properties, is able to withstand higher ripple currents during normal operation. This series is ideally suited for industrial and commercial applications.

Technical Specifications
| Series | Type | Capacitance Range | Rated Voltage (VDC) | Operating Temperature | Capacitance Tolerance | Life Test | ESR (m) |
| A759 | Radial Solid Polymer Aluminum Capacitors | 2.2 2,200 F | 6.3 250 | 55C to +125C | 20% at 120 Hz/20C | 125C/2,000 hours | See Ordering Options Table |
Performance Characteristics
| Item | Performance Characteristics |
| Leakage Current | I 0.15 CV or 120 A, whichever is greater |
| Dissipation Factor (tan ) | 0.12 (maximum) at 120 Hz/20C for 35 250 VDC |
| Compensation Factor of Ripple Current (RC) vs. Frequency | 120 Hz f < 1 kHz: 0.05 1 kHz f < 10 kHz: 0.30 10 kHz f < 100 kHz: 0.70 100 kHz f < 500 kHz: 1.00 |
Test Method & Performance Conditions
| Test | Conditions | Performance |
| Load Life Test | Temperature: 125C Test Duration: 2,000 hours Ripple Current: No ripple current applied Voltage: Sum of DC and peak AC voltage rated voltage | Capacitance Change: Within 20% of initial value Dissipation Factor: Does not exceed 150% of specified value ESR: Does not exceed 150% of specified value Leakage Current: Does not exceed specified value |
| Shelf Life Test | Temperature: 125C Test Duration: 96 hours Ripple Current: No ripple current applied Voltage: No voltage applied | Capacitance Change: Within 20% of initial value Dissipation Factor: Does not exceed 150% of specified value ESR: Does not exceed 150% of specified value Leakage Current: Does not exceed specified value |
| Damp Heat | Rated voltage applied for 1,000 hours at 60C, 90%~95% RH | Capacitance Change: Within 20% of initial value Dissipation Factor: Does not exceed 150% of specified value ESR: Does not exceed 150% of specified value Leakage Current: Does not exceed specified value |
| Surge Voltage | 1,000 cycles, each consisting of charge with surge voltages (Rated Voltage x 1.15) at 105C for 30 seconds (Rc = 1 k) and discharge for 5 minutes, 30 seconds. | Capacitance Change: Within 20% of initial value Dissipation Factor: Does not exceed 150% of specified value ESR: Does not exceed 150% of specified value Leakage Current: Does not exceed specified value |
Shelf Life & Re-Ageing
Shelf life is 12 months. Suitable storage conditions are +5 to +35C and less than 75% relative humidity. Re-age procedure: Apply rated DC voltage at 125C for 120 minutes through a 1 k series resistor.

Applications
Typical applications include long life LED drivers, professional power amplifiers, industrial power supplies, DC/DC converters, voltage regulators, and decoupling.
